This Thunderbolt Application Is Not in Use Anymore and Can Be Safely Uninstalled

Summary
How to resolve installation error on Thunderbolt 3.

Description
After every system restart, a Windows® 10 error message pops up: Application Cannot run – This Thunderbolt application is not in use anymore and can be safely uninstalled.

Resolution
Steps to remove legacy Thunderbolt™ 3 driver:

  1. Disconnect any Thunderbolt 3 devices from the computer.
  2. Right-click on the Windows Start button and select Device Manager.
  3. Click on View from the application menu bar, and click the option Show hidden devices.
  4. Expand the System Devices category. Scroll down until you find the entry for the Thunderbolt Controller.
  5. Right-click on the Thunderbolt Controller entry and select Uninstall device from the context menu that appears.
  6. From the Uninstall Device window that appears, click to place a check mark within the Delete the driver software for this device option.
  7. Click the Uninstall button.
  8. Close Device Manager.
  9. Search for CMD in the Windows taskbar.
  10. Right-click on the Command Prompt search result and select Run as Administrator.
  11. From the Administrative Command Prompt window, type sc delete nhi and press enter.
  12. Wait for action confirmation [SC] DeleteService SUCCESS then close the Command Prompt.
  13. Type appwiz.cpl in the Windows task bar search, check Applications and Features for any Thunderbolt Software by Intel entries listed. If present, uninstall.
  14. Download and follow installation instructions of the latest Thunderbolt™ 3 DCH Driver for Windows® 10 for Intel® NUC.
  15. Download and install the Thunderbolt Control Center software from the Microsoft Store to approve and manage Thunderbolt devices.

Additional information

Why this is happening:

The original Intel Thunderbolt Controller driver that was released when Thunderbolt 3 systems were first introduced was based on a different driver model from Microsoft’s new DCH driver model. This driver package included both the driver and software management utility within the single installer.

The new DCH version of the Intel Thunderbolt Host Controller driver is provided separately from the software management utility. The driver is intended to be used in conjunction with the Universal Windows Platform (UWP) version of Intel Thunderbolt Control Center application.

Because the non-DCH and DCH driver versions and utilities cannot be mixed, if a system is updated to the new DCH Thunderbolt driver, the non-DCH version of the software management utility will no longer work and the error message will appear.
